コード例 #1
0
  @Override
  public Role findRoleById(String id) {
    if (!StringUtils.hasText(id)) {
      return null;
    }

    Role r = roleDao.findOne(id);
    if (r != null) {
      r.getPermissionSet().size();
      r.getMenuSet().size();
    }

    return r;
  }
コード例 #2
0
 @Override
 public Long countAllRoles() {
   return roleDao.count();
 }
コード例 #3
0
 @Override
 public Page<Role> findAllRoles(Pageable pageable) {
   return roleDao.findAll(pageable);
 }
コード例 #4
0
 @Override
 public void delete(Role role) {
   roleDao.delete(role);
 }
コード例 #5
0
 @Override
 public void save(Role role) {
   roleDao.save(role);
 }